... Read morePushing yourself to achieve new personal records, like hitting a challenging 280-pound incline press, can be tough but incredibly rewarding. From my experience, the key to success is maintaining consistent motivation and not letting doubts or setbacks hold you back. One way I stay motivated is by breaking my goals into smaller milestones. For example, instead of focusing solely on the 280-pound target, I celebrate incremental improvements each week. This approach keeps motivation high and builds confidence gradually. Another helpful tip is to visualize success. Before hitting the incline press, I imagine completing the rep with perfect form and feeling the strength in my muscles. This mental rehearsal prepares my mind and body to perform at their best. Also, don't underestimate the power of community support and sharing your progress.
